Higgipedia. I'm given to understand that this will be the new introductory adventure for the Grindhouse edition of LotFP. I think the adventure will be successful in that role because it:
- starts gently, and invites the players to root their characters in the world
- asks the players to think deeply about the situation by not providing them with an easy, obvious course of action
- shows the players that their actions have significant ramifications in the broader game world (recalling a favorite Raggi theme, though without locking the referee into quite such a catastrophic outcome in this case)
While my impressions are from the perspective of a player, and this was not the final version, I can confidently say that, as much as I enjoyed
Stargazer, this new adventure uses a similarly familiar trope to create far more engaging play situations for both the players and the referee.
